The Challenge of Multi-Region Delivery Consistency
Professional services firms operating across multiple regions face a unique set of challenges when implementing Enterprise Resource Planning (ERP) systems. Unlike manufacturing or retail, where physical inventory and supply chain logistics dominate, professional services rely on human capital, project management, and time-based billing. The core objective of an ERP rollout in this context is not just financial consolidation, but the standardization of service delivery processes. Without a unified platform, regional offices often develop disparate workflows, leading to inconsistent client experiences, fragmented financial reporting, and inefficient resource allocation. The goal of professional services ERP rollout planning for multi-region delivery consistency is to create a single source of truth that balances central control with local operational flexibility.
Inconsistency in delivery manifests in several ways: varying project approval thresholds, different time-tracking methodologies, and inconsistent billing practices. These variances make it difficult for C-suite executives to gain a real-time view of profitability across the organization. Furthermore, when regional teams operate on different systems or configurations, knowledge transfer becomes hindered, and best practices do not scale effectively. A well-planned ERP implementation addresses these issues by enforcing standardized processes while allowing for necessary local adaptations in compliance, currency, and language.
Strategic Foundation: Discovery and Requirements Gathering
The foundation of a successful multi-region rollout lies in comprehensive discovery. This phase involves mapping current-state processes in each region to identify variances and best practices. It is critical to engage stakeholders from all levels, including project managers, finance teams, and client-facing staff, to understand their pain points and requirements. The discovery process should not merely document existing workflows but should also challenge them, identifying opportunities for process reengineering that align with the firm's strategic goals.
Requirements gathering must distinguish between functional requirements, which define what the system must do, and non-functional requirements, which define how the system must perform. For professional services, key functional requirements include project management, resource planning, time and expense tracking, billing, and financial reporting. Non-functional requirements encompass scalability, security, integration capabilities, and user experience. A robust requirements matrix should prioritize these needs, ensuring that the ERP solution can support the firm's growth and adapt to changing business conditions.
Architecture and Deployment Strategy
Choosing the right architecture is pivotal for multi-region consistency. A centralized cloud-based ERP architecture is often preferred for its ability to provide a single instance of the application, ensuring that all regions operate on the same version and configuration. This approach simplifies maintenance, updates, and security management. However, data residency and privacy regulations may require a hybrid approach, where certain data is stored locally while the application logic remains centralized. The architecture must also support robust integration capabilities, allowing the ERP to connect with other systems such as CRM, HR, and specialized project management tools.
Deployment strategy is another critical decision. A big-bang approach, where all regions go live simultaneously, offers the advantage of a single cutover event and immediate consistency. However, it carries higher risk, as any issues affect the entire organization. A phased rollout, where regions are implemented sequentially, allows for learning and refinement in early phases, reducing the risk of widespread failure. The choice between these approaches depends on the firm's risk appetite, the complexity of the implementation, and the availability of resources. A hybrid approach, where core regions go live first and others follow, is often a balanced solution.
Data Migration and Master Data Management
Data migration is one of the most complex aspects of an ERP implementation. In a multi-region environment, data is often fragmented across various systems, spreadsheets, and local databases. The migration process must include data profiling to understand the quality and structure of existing data, cleansing to remove duplicates and errors, and mapping to align source data with the target ERP schema. Master data management (MDM) is essential to ensure that key entities such as clients, projects, and resources are consistent across all regions. Without a robust MDM strategy, the ERP will inherit the inconsistencies of the legacy systems, undermining the goal of delivery consistency.
Migration testing is critical to validate the accuracy and completeness of the migrated data. This involves reconciling source and target data, ensuring that financial balances match, and verifying that project histories are intact. Cutover controls must be in place to manage the transition from legacy systems to the new ERP, including data freeze periods and rollback plans. The migration process should be iterative, with multiple test cycles to refine the mapping and transformation rules.
Integration and System Connectivity
An ERP system does not operate in isolation. It must integrate with other enterprise applications to provide a seamless user experience and ensure data flow. For professional services firms, key integrations include CRM for client management, HR systems for employee data, and specialized tools for project collaboration. Integration architecture should be designed to be scalable and resilient, using APIs and middleware to facilitate data exchange. Event-driven integration can ensure real-time updates, while batch processing can handle large data volumes efficiently.
Security and governance are paramount in integration design. Access controls must be enforced at the API level, ensuring that only authorized systems and users can access sensitive data. Audit trails should be maintained to track data changes and ensure compliance with regulatory requirements. The integration strategy should also consider data privacy regulations, such as GDPR, which may require data to be processed in specific regions. A well-designed integration architecture enhances the value of the ERP by providing a unified view of the business.
Change Management and User Adoption
Technology alone does not ensure success; people are the key to ERP adoption. Change management is a critical component of the implementation plan, focusing on preparing, supporting, and helping individuals and organizations in making a change. In a multi-region environment, change management must be tailored to the cultural and operational differences of each region. Communication plans should be developed to keep stakeholders informed and engaged throughout the implementation process. Training programs must be comprehensive, covering both technical skills and process changes.
User acceptance testing (UAT) is a crucial step in ensuring that the system meets user needs. UAT should involve end-users from all regions, testing real-world scenarios to identify any gaps or issues. Feedback from UAT should be incorporated into the final configuration and customization. Post-go-live support is also essential, providing users with assistance as they adapt to the new system. A dedicated support team should be available to address issues and provide guidance, ensuring a smooth transition.
Governance and Continuous Improvement
Effective governance is essential for maintaining the integrity and value of the ERP system over time. A governance framework should define roles and responsibilities, decision-making processes, and change management procedures. This includes managing configuration changes, ensuring that they are tested and approved before deployment. Governance also involves monitoring system performance and usage, identifying areas for improvement and optimization. Regular reviews should be conducted to assess the system's alignment with business goals and to identify opportunities for enhancement.
Continuous improvement is a key principle of ERP management. The system should be treated as a living entity, evolving with the business. This involves regular updates, new feature adoption, and process refinement. A culture of continuous improvement encourages users to provide feedback and suggest enhancements, fostering a sense of ownership and engagement. By maintaining a strong governance framework and a commitment to continuous improvement, firms can ensure that their ERP system remains a strategic asset, supporting multi-region delivery consistency and business growth.
